The Monkey’s Paw and Life is Sweet at Kumanensu are similar In that they both deal With magic, but the Monkey’s Paw deals With black magic and Life is Sweet at Kumanensu deals with spiritual magic. Both of these stories had magic in them but the magic type was very different. The Monkeys Paw had Black magic in it. The Monkey’s Paw had a Paw that was said to be cursed. If you made a wish with the paw your Wish would come true but there would be great repercussions. After the man wished for 200 pounds his son was killed by machinery, Mr. White and Mrs. White blamed the paw and believed that the paw was cursed. The other Wishes they made were to make Herbert alive again and to send him back.

The Monkey’s paw was a very good story that didn’t actually tell you that there was magic in it. The author let the reader believe what he wanted. Life is Sweet at Kumanensu was a story about spiritual magic. The story had spiritual magic because the same baby was believed to be being born over and over again. The fifth time the baby was born the mother marked him with a stick to see if it really was being reborn. When the baby was reborn it did have a mark on it.

Her son grew up and rarely visited home when he came to visit he had a scarf wrapped around his head. He said that if he didn’t have it on his head would fall off. Some of the village people came to her house to tell her that her son was dead. She told them that he was just at her house. They said that he had his head cut off. At the end of the story, the people were looking at a locket and they couldn’t find out how to open it. The little girl showed them about a secret release that opened it, this proved that her son had been at her house.
